Product Overview
5,5-Dibromobarbituric acid (CAS 511-67-1), with molecular formula C4H2Br2N2O3 and molecular weight 283.84323 g/mol. IUPAC: 5,5-dibromo-1,3-diazinane-2,4,6-trione.
